(Witham Road, Terling & Terling Road, Witham) (Temporary Prohibition of Traffic) Order 2017
Notice is hereby given that the Essex County Council intends, not less than seven days from the date of this notice, to make the above Order under Section 14(1) of the Road Traffic Regulation Act 1984.
Effect of the order: To temporarily close those lengths of Witham Road, Terling and Terling Road, Witham in the District of Braintree, from the junction with Hatfield Road to the junction with Powershall End, a distance of approximately 3126 m. The closure is scheduled to commence on 21st June 2017 for 7 days, or where stated on a valid permit. The scheduled dates may vary for these works (EP201EH2225884 & EP201EH2225827- Essex County Council) with appropriate signs showing and/or displayed on www.roadworks.org. The closure is required for the safety of the public and workforce while carriageway patching works are undertaken by Essex County Council.
An alternative route is available via Hatfield Road, New Road, Owls Hill, Braintree Road, Fuller Street, Boreham Road, Main Road, London Road, London Road Roundabout, London Road Roundabout North, Great Notley Avenue, Bakers Lane, Church Road, Notley Road, The Street, Witham Road, The Green, Church Hill, Faulkbourne Road, Flora Road, Powers Hall End and vice versa. The Order will come into effect on 1st June 2017 and may continue in force for 18 months or until the works have been completed, whichever is the earlier
(Bridge End, Great Bardfield & Bridge Street, Great Bardfield) (Temporary Prohibition of Traffic) Order 2017
Notice is hereby given that the Essex County Council intends, not less than seven days from the date of this notice, to make the above Order under Section 14(1) of the Road Traffic Regulation Act 1984.
Effect of the order: To temporarily close those lengths of Bridge End, Great Bardfield & Bridge Street, Great Bardfield in the District of Braintree, from its junction with Northampton Meadow to its junction with Beslyns Road for a distance of approximately 318m in a northerly direction. The closure is scheduled to commence on 10th July 2017 for 5 days, or where stated on a valid permit. The scheduled dates may vary for these works (BC005MU1WBAUSEIBPGFEGZ08 - BT) with appropriate signs showing and/or displayed on www.roadworks.org. The closure is required for the safety of the public and workforce while spine cabling works are undertaken by BT. An alternative route is available via Bridge Street, Vine Street, Dunmow Road, Oxen End, Dunmow Road From Lindsell To Duck End, Dunmow Road From Bran End To Broadway, The Broadway, Church End, Church Street, Lime Tree Hill, Beaumont Hill, Mill End, Watling Street, Newbiggen Street, Walden Road, Great Sampford Road, Thaxted Road, Hill Road, Finchingfield Road, Hawkins Hill, Brent Hall Road, Green Road, Bardfield Road, Bridge End and vice versa.
The Order will come into effect on 1st June 2017 and may continue in force for 18 months or until the works have been completed, whichever is the earlier Dated: 18/05/2017
